Python openCV 人脸识别 入门

import cv2
# 读图片
img = cv2.imread(r"D:\Desktop\hk1.png")
# 按比例改变大小
img = cv2.resize(img, (int(img.shape[1]/3) , int(img.shape[0]/3) ))
# 转灰度
gray = cv2.cvtColor(img,cv2.COLOR_BGR2GRAY)
# 导训练数据
face_cascade = cv2.CascadeClassifier(r"D:\Python\Python37\Lib\site-packages\cv2\data\haarcascade_frontalface_default.xml")
# 用数据 ScaleFactor 为 每次缩小的比例 minNeighbors 识别次数
faces = face_cascade.detectMultiScale(gray,scaleFactor = 1.1,minNeighbors = 10)
# 画框
for x,y,w,h in faces:
    # 矩阵,最小外接圆的左上角点,右下角点,RGB ,线宽
    img = cv2.rectangle(img,(x,y),(x+w,y+h),(120,220,110),3)
# 展图片 标题栏名称 矩阵
cv2.imshow('hankai',img)
import cv2
img = cv2.imread(r'D:\Desktop\tu1.png',0)#0灰度 1彩色 -1带透明度的彩色
cv2.imshow('tu1',img)
k = cv2.waitKey(0)
if k == 27:# esc键
    cv2.destroyWindow('tu1')
elif k == 115:# S键
    cv2.imwrite(r'D:\Desktop\tu6.png',img)
    cv2.destroyAllWindows()# 关闭所有窗口
